European Leaf-toed Gecko

Euleptes europaea

The European Leaf-toed Gecko is a small, colorful lizard that loves to hide among leaves and rocks. It has special toes that help it climb and stick to surfaces, making it a great little explorer in its home!

Hábitat: Forests

Aspecto

The European Leaf-toed Gecko is a small, slender reptile with a flattened body and head. It has distinctive, specialized toe pads that resemble tiny leaves, aiding its climbing. Its coloration is typically grey, brownish, or reddish, often mottled with darker spots to blend seamlessly with rocky surroundings.

Datos interesantes

Female geckos often glue their eggs to hidden spots, like under rocks or bark.

Its scientific name, Euleptes, means 'fine' or 'slender one' in Greek!

These geckos communicate with soft chirps and clicks, especially during mating!

They can go for long periods without water, getting moisture from dew or food.
